Description

This form is a Class Action Complaint. Plaintiffs seek damages and injunctive relief from defendants for liability under the Racketeer Influenced and Corrupt Organizations Act(RICO). Plaintiffs contend that the defendants' actions justify an award of substantial punitive damages against each.

The Connecticut Unfair Insurance Practices Act, or CuIPA, is a law designed to protect consumers from unfair practices by insurance companies. It prohibits insurers from engaging in deceptive actions, ensuring that policyholders receive fair treatment.
